Kas ir $0 Perl?
Kas ir $0 Perl?

Video: Kas ir $0 Perl?

Video: Kas ir $0 Perl?
Video: CS50 2015 - Week 7, continued 2024, Oktobris
Anonim

$0 . $0 satur palaistās programmas nosaukumu, kas dots čaulai. Ja programma tika palaists tieši caur Perl tulks, $0 satur faila nosaukumu.

Attiecīgi, ko tas nozīmē Perl?

Tātad nozīmē glob(qq) vai glob('*'). glob izmanto, lai no raksta ģenerētu vairākas virknes vai failu nosaukumus. Saraksta kontekstā aka glob('*') atgriež visus pašreizējā darba direktorijā esošos failus, izņemot tos, kuru nosaukums sākas ar..

Kā arī, ko Perlā nozīmē $#? 1. 16. In Perl , jūs saņemat @masīva pēdējā elementa indeksu ar sintaksi $# masīvs. Tātad $#_ ir masīva pēdējā elementa indekss @_. Tas nav tas pats, kas elementu skaits masīvā (ko iegūstat ar skalāru @masīvs), jo Perl masīvi parasti ir balstīti uz 0.

Ko šajā sakarā Perl nozīmē $_?

$_ ir īpašs mainīgais, kas satur pēdējās atbilstošās izteiksmes vērtību vai starpvērtību cilpās, piemēram, for, while utt., ja nesaglabājat šo atbilstošo izteiksmi precīzos mainīgajos. [atbildēt] Re^2: Kas dara to nozīmē " $_ ”. PERL.

Kas ir argv valodā Perl?

Perl komandrindas argumenti, kas saglabāti īpašajā masīvā ar nosaukumu @ ARGV . Masīvs @ ARGV satur skriptam paredzētos komandrindas argumentus. $# ARGV parasti ir argumentu skaits mīnus viens, jo $ ARGV [0] ir pirmais arguments, nevis pats programmas komandas nosaukums.

Ieteicams: